Hurl Rocks Park in Myrtle Beach, South Carolina, is a unique beach known for its striking rocky formations that emerge from the sand, creating a picturesque landscape along the otherwise smooth coastline. Located on South Ocean Boulevard, it offers a serene escape for nature enthusiasts and beachgoers alike. The park is rich in history, established as part of Myrtle Beach's efforts to preserve natural and historical landmarks. Visitors can enjoy activities like photography, picnicking, and exploring tide pools around the rocks, which are home to a variety of marine life. The park is also a great spot for bird watching, with many coastal species frequently sighted.

The beach itself is approximately 0.5 miles long and features soft, white sand. It is conveniently located near the Myrtle Beach Boardwalk, offering access to numerous shops, restaurants, and attractions. However, the park has limited amenities, so visitors should plan accordingly. Dogs are allowed on the beach, but there are no lifeguards on duty, so caution is advised when entering the water.

Hurl Rocks Park provides a tranquil atmosphere, making it a must-visit destination for those seeking a quieter side of Myrtle Beach. Its unique geological features and historical significance enrich the visitor experience, offering a blend of natural beauty and educational value.

Hurl Rocks Park has limited amenities, which means visitors should plan their trip accordingly. The park offers bathroom access, and dogs are allowed on the beach. However, there are no lifeguards on duty, so caution is advised when swimming. Picnic tables are available, allowing families and groups to enjoy meals with the ocean as their backdrop. The park's serene atmosphere and lack of commercial activities ensure that the natural landscape remains unspoiled and tranquil. For those looking for more amenities, nearby Myrtle Beach attractions like the Boardwalk offer a variety of shops and restaurants.

Visitors to Hurl Rocks Park can enjoy a range of activities. Swimming and sunbathing are popular, although the absence of lifeguards means swimmers should exercise caution. The park is excellent for beachcombing and exploring the tide pools around the rocks, which are home to a variety of marine life. Bird watching is another favorite activity, with many coastal species frequently sighted. A leisurely stroll along the shoreline offers ample opportunities to discover the natural beauty of the area. Additionally, the nearby Myrtle Beach Boardwalk and Broadway at the Beach provide access to more entertainment options like mini-golf and an aquarium.

Hurl Rocks Park does not have specific accommodations for people with disabilities. However, nearby attractions and hotels often provide wheelchair-accessible facilities, including entrances, restrooms, and seating areas. Visitors with mobility needs may want to explore these options for a more accessible experience. The park itself is generally flat and accessible by foot, but the lack of dedicated ramps or wheelchair rentals means that visitors should plan ahead if they require these services.

Parking at Hurl Rocks Park is primarily street parking near the entrance. There is no dedicated parking lot, but visitors can usually find spots along the street. The proximity to the beach makes it convenient for those who prefer a more secluded and natural beach experience. For those staying in nearby hotels or visiting other attractions, additional parking options may be available, depending on the specific location.

One of the most fascinating aspects of Hurl Rocks Park is its unique geological feature—weathered rocks emerging from the sand. These formations have been shaped over millions of years and provide a dramatic contrast to the smooth sands typical of Myrtle Beach. Historically, the park was noted by William Bartram, an 18th-century naturalist, who described the area's natural beauty. Today, the park remains a tranquil escape from the bustling Myrtle Beach scene, offering a glimpse into the area's natural and historical past.
